Nestled along the vibrant coastline of Barcelona, Port Olímpic is a captivating marina that seamlessly blends modern allure with historical significance. Originally constructed for the 1992 Olympic Games, this once neglected area has transformed into a bustling hub, offering a unique blend of leisure, culture, and nightlife. El Peix d’Or

Prepare to be dazzled by the architectural brilliance of El Peix d’Or, a masterpiece by the legendary Frank Gehry. This gleaming copper sculpture, affectionately known as 'The Golden Fish,' stands as a symbol of Port Olimpic's innovative spirit. Its futuristic design and shimmering surface create a captivating sight that draws visitors from all over the world. Whether you're an art enthusiast or simply looking for the perfect photo opportunity, El Peix d’Or is a must-see landmark that embodies the artistic flair of Barcelona.

Beaches

Sun, sand, and sea await you at the beautiful beaches flanking Port Olimpic. With Barceloneta and Nova Icaria just a stone's throw away, these sandy stretches offer the perfect escape for sunbathing, swimming, and soaking up the vibrant beach culture. Whether you're looking to relax under the warm Mediterranean sun or dive into the refreshing waves, the beaches near Port Olimpic provide a quintessential Barcelona experience. Culture and History

Port Olímpic holds a special place in Barcelona's history, having been a key site during the 1992 Summer Olympics. Its transformation into a modern marina is a testament to the city's dynamic evolution, showcasing the blend of historical significance with modern development.

Local Cuisine

Indulge in the flavors of Catalonia at Port Olímpic, where a variety of dining options await. From fresh seafood to traditional tapas, and from casual beachside eateries to upscale restaurants, the culinary offerings are as diverse as they are delicious, all with stunning sea views.

Nightlife

As the sun sets, Port Olímpic transforms into a vibrant nightlife hub. With a range of bars, clubs, and lounges, including popular spots like Opium Barcelona and Ice Bar, visitors can enjoy an exciting night out by the sea.
